Standard genetic assessment based on 33 autosomal STR loci
| N | Na | Ne | Ho | He | F | ||
|---|---|---|---|---|---|---|---|
| Mean | 91 | 7.939 | 3.826 | 0.684 | 0.706 | 0.031 | |
| SE | 0.418 | 0.213 | 0.019 | 0.019 | 0.010 |
Standard genetic assessment based on 7 STRs in the DLA region
| N | Na | Ne | Ho | He | F | ||
|---|---|---|---|---|---|---|---|
| Mean | 91 | 6.286 | 3.006 | 0.672 | 0.660 | -0.020 | |
| SE | 0.389 | 0.149 | 0.021 | 0.022 | 0.015 |
